Will be very interesting to see what Carolina does.  Next year they have $6 million in cap space with only 17 players signed.  Even assuming Ryan Murphy is on the team next year, he's a little above the average cap hit for one of the five players they need to fill the roster. 

 

I look at the roster, and they'll have to dump at least one quality player, either in a trade or by amensty, to have enough cap breathing space next year.  Perhaps some quality for quantity move. 

 

EDIT:  Vancouver is going to be in a world of pain next year.  $1.37 million in cap space with seven unfilled roster spots.

It's a tough call.  The closer it gets to the time you have to get under the cap (opening of training camp?), the more desperate a team is to dump salary, and, the lower the return.  If we assume that the Canucks have to get rid of Luongo one way or the other, they would probably get the most out of him by trading him sooner rather than later.

 

I guess you could look at the flip side though, in that a bad team will not be desperate to make a move now, but might become more interested in the off season, which will increase the number of buyers.  An example would be Tampa as a possible destination for Luongo.
